WebJan 11, 2024 · In survival mode: the player must maintain the level of their health, hunger, thirst, and oxygen. If they die, the player respawn with whatever they had saved in the life pod before leaving it, but any items that haven’t been saved to it and obtained after leaving the pod are considered lost. WebFeb 26, 2016 · The short answer is: Yes. You do, in fact, get the resources back from deconstruction. If you want to deconstruct a Seabase module, equip the Habitat Builder and hold "E" while facing the module. The materials used to create the module will be returned to your Inventory.
